    Magnesium plays an important role in lowering the risk of cardiovascular disease.Foods like spinach, broccoli and peas are excellent sources of magnesium.Whole wheat bread and other grain foods offer a nutritious source of magnesium.White beans, black beans, pinto beans and lima beans are excellent ways to add fiber and magnesium to the diet.
